What Actually Happens When Tooth Decay Is Left Untreated
A cavity is not simply a “small hole.”
It is an active bacterial infection that gradually destroys tooth structure over time.
In the early stages, decay affects only the outer enamel layer. During this stage, a small dental filling in Singapore is usually simple, quick, and affordable.
But when treatment is delayed:
bacteria spread deeper into the dentin
tooth sensitivity increases
chewing discomfort develops
the tooth structure weakens
Eventually, the infection may reach the nerve inside the tooth.
At that point, patients searching for a simple tooth filling may instead require:
root canal treatment
dental crowns
extraction if the damage is severe
This is why early cavity treatment is always preferable.
The Hidden Places Cavities Commonly Start
Many cavities are not visible in the mirror.
Dentists frequently find decay:
between teeth
under old fillings
near the gumline
inside deep grooves of molars
These hidden cavities may continue growing for months before obvious pain appears.

Why Tooth-Coloured Fillings Are Popular in Singapore
Most patients today prefer composite tooth fillings in Singapore instead of traditional silver fillings.
Composite fillings are designed to blend naturally with surrounding teeth, making them far less noticeable.

Why Some Fillings Need Replacement Earlier
Not all tooth fillings last the same amount of time.
Several factors affect how long a filling remains stable.
Teeth Grinding and Clenching
Grinding places excessive pressure on fillings, especially back molars.
This can eventually lead to:
cracks
filling wear
tooth fractures
Sugary and Acidic Drinks
Frequent exposure to:
soft drinks
sweet coffee
bubble tea
acidic beverages
can increase the risk of new decay forming around existing fillings.
Poor Oral Hygiene
Even after getting a tooth filling in Ang Mo Kio, bacteria can still accumulate if brushing and flossing habits are poor.
Large Cavities
Bigger cavities usually require larger fillings, which naturally experience more stress during chewing.

How Dentists Detect Cavities Early
One reason cavities become severe is because patients wait until symptoms become obvious.
Dentists often detect early decay using:
clinical examination
bitewing X-rays
visual inspection
cavity detection tools
Small cavities discovered early may require only minor tooth fillings, preserving more healthy tooth structure.

Tooth Filling Cost in Singapore
One of the most searched questions is:
“How much does a tooth filling in Singapore cost?”
The cost depends on:
cavity size
filling material
tooth location
complexity of treatment
Typical price ranges include:
Treatment | Estimated Cost |
Small composite tooth filling | $85 – $115 |
Medium dental filling | $95 – $130 |
Larger restorations | $95 – $150 |
Molars and deeper cavities may require more extensive restoration work.
